Where to Find Deer

You’ll mostly find deer wandering around Bramblemead Valley. They’re hard to miss thanks to their big antlers and habit of bolting the second they sense movement.

Can You Use Melee?

Technically, yes. Realistically? No.

Deer are fast, easily spooked, and absolutely not interested in getting clubbed. If you try melee, you’ll end up chasing pixelated venison through the woods until nightfall. So let’s go ranged.

How to Make Arrows

If you don’t already have Fang Arrows, use Stone Arrows. You get 33 arrows per craft:

  • 1x Stone

  • 1x Ash Log

  • 1x Feather

Time to Hunt

  1. Equip your Ash Shortbow.

  2. Crouch (press C) and sneak up on the deer.

  3. Shoot once — that’s all it takes.

  4. Walk over and collect Antlers, Raw Meat, and maybe some Bones.
